The Image Workbench is no longer included after version 0.20.
Its functionality has been integrated in Std Base. See Std Import and Std ViewLoadImage.
Image workbench icon

简介

图像工作台用于管理不同类型的位图图像,用户可借此在FreeCAD中打开这些图像。

工具

  • Open: 在新的视口中打开图像。
  • Import to plane: 将图像导入至3D视图中的平面内。
  • Scaling: 对导入至平面内的图像进行缩放处理。

特性

  • 草图相似,我们可将导入的图像附于XY,XZ或YZ主平面之一,并为之调整正、负偏移值。
  • 导入图像的比例关系为1像素:1毫米。
  • 建议导入具有合理分辨率的图像。

Workflow

工作流程

图形工作台的一个主要用途就是借助底图草图工具对目标图像进行描边,即为了基于目标图像的轮廓来生成对应实体。

若要进行描边处理,最好是令图像距工作平面有个较小的负偏移量,例如-0.1 mm。这就意味着图像将稍稍偏于绘制2D几何图形平面的后侧,继而就不会把2D底图/草图绘制在图像上了。

可在导入图像时设置其偏移量,或者在后面的处理流程中通过修改其属性来实现这一点。
